Title:
  Qemu can not parse long fqdns during drive-mirror

Status in QEMU:
  New
Status in qemu package in Ubuntu:
  Confirmed

Bug description:
  During migration of an openstack booted instance, I got the following
  error:

  Apr 12 10:55:22 cmp1 libvirtd[4133]: 2018-04-12 10:55:22.133+0000:
  4139: error : qemuMonitorJSONCheckError:392 : internal error: unable
  to execute QEMU command 'drive-mirror': error parsing address 'cmp0
  .sandriichenko-deploy-heat-virtual-mcp-pike-ovs-76.bud-mk.local:49153'

  A bit more info in libvirt bug
  https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1568939

  To reproduce it with qemu only, I followed the guide at
  https://github.com/qemu/qemu/blob/master/docs/interop/live-block-
  operations.rst#id21. On dest and source compute nodes, I launched an
  instance:

  qemu-system-x86_64 -display none -nodefconfig -M q35 -nodefaults -m
  512 -blockdev node-name=node-
  TargetDisk,driver=qcow2,file.driver=file,file.node-
  name=file,file.filename=./test-instance-mirror.qcow2 -device virtio-
  blk,drive=node-TargetDisk,id=virtio0 -S -monitor stdio -qmp unix
  :./qmp-sock,server,nowait -incoming tcp:localhost:6666

  Then on dest node I launched nbd server:

  (qemu) nbd_server_start cmp0:49153
  (qemu) nbd_server_add -w node-TargetDisk

  On the source node:

  (qemu) drive_mirror -n  node-TargetDisk 
nbd:cmp0.vdrok-deploy-heat-virtual-mcp-pike-ovs-foobarbuzz.bud-mk.local:49153:exportname=node-TargetDisk
  error parsing address 
'cmp0.vdrok-deploy-heat-virtual-mcp-pike-ovs-foobarbuzz.bud-mk.local:49153'

  When using short host name instead of FQDN address seems to be parsed
  fine:

  (qemu) drive_mirror -n  node-TargetDisk 
nbd:cmp0:49153:exportname=node-TargetDisk qcow2
  Image is not in qcow2 format

  (not sure why it is not a qcow2 format, as I have qcow2 image with raw
  backing file, but this is unrelated)

  QEMU version is 2.11.1 from bionic
